The Case Manager works as a team member with several social service professional and paraprofessional staff ensuring the delivery of quality care in accordance to the rules and regulations established as well as adhering to the mission of St. Joseph Center.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ES

The Case Manager’s key areas of responsibility include :

Key Areas of Responsibility :

  • Develop and maintain strong ties to the community, law enforcement, and other homeless service providers.
  • Link clients to appropriate bridge / interim housing programs and assist them in completing required paperwork to enroll them in permanent housing-related programs.

Essential Duties :

  • Provide case management and supportive services to meet the needs of each individual.
  • Build trust and rapport with individuals experiencing homelessness. Assess homeless individuals utilizing the Vulnerability Index (VI) SPDAT.
  • Link clients to physical health, mental health, and other supportive services. Assist clients to enroll in mainstream benefits and obtain identification (i.

e. California Driver’s License, Social Security Card).

  • Keep highly organized files for each client and enter appropriate data into the region’s Homeless Management Information System (HMIS).
  • Provide bus tokens, bus passes, taxi vouchers, and / or direct transportation as needed.
  • Participate in case conferencing meetings and other community meetings.
  • Coordinate with other outreach teams in joint outreach efforts.

Qualifications

Knowledge, Skills & Abilities :

Must be highly motivated and a self-starter. The ability to communicate with and relate to a diverse group of people including clients, community, and other staff.

Must have excellent organizational skills and the capability to work in a fast paced environment.

  • Strong knowledge of homeless services and resources. Demonstrated knowledge and experience with Harm Reduction, Motivational Interviewing, Critical Time Intervention, and Housing First.
  • A bilingual background is a plus.
  • The position requires an ability to work flexible hours including some early mornings and evenings.

Experience :

Two years of experience providing services to highly vulnerable populations.

Education :

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university in Psychology, Social Work, Human Services or a related field.
